Will the IRS catch a missing 1099 after?
Will the IRS catch a missing 1099? The IRS knows about any income that gets reported on a 1099, even if you forgot to include it on your tax return. This is because a business that sends you a Form 1099 also reports the information to the IRS.

Does a 1099-C affect your credit?
The lender files this form with the IRS and a copy is supposed to be sent to the taxpayer as well. A copy of the 1099-C is not supplied to credit reporting agencies, though, so in that respect, the fact that you received the form has no impact on credit reports or scores whatsoever.

Which 1099 can you not import into TurboTax?
These 1099 forms can't be imported:
- 1099-A Acquisition/Abandonment of Property.
- 1099-C Cancelation of Debt.
- 1099-G Government and Unemployment payments.
- 1099-LTC Long Term Care & Accelerated Death Benefits.
- 1099-PATR Taxable Cooperative Distributions.
- 1099-Q Qualified Education Payments.

Where do I enter 1099-NEC on my tax return?
You'll use the amount in Box 1 on your Form 1099-NEC to report your self-employment income. Instead of putting this information directly on Form 1040, you'll report it on Schedule C.

How much tax will I pay on my 1099 income?
Small-business owners, contractors, freelancers, gig workers, and others who make more than a $400 profit must pay self-employment tax. Self-employed workers are taxed at 15.3% of 92.35% of net profit. This 15.3% is a combination of Social Security (12.4%) and Medicare (2.9%) taxes, also known as FICA taxes.
Where does 1099 income go on a tax form?
I received a Form 1099-NEC with an amount in box 1 for nonemployee compensation. What forms and schedules should I use to report income earned as an independent contractor? Independent contractors generally report their income on Schedule C (Form 1040), Profit or Loss from Business (Sole Proprietorship).
